The Failure of Discontinued Erez TPO Flat Roof Membranes
The existing Erez TPO roof had reached the absolute end of its operational life. Over years of exposure to intense Florida UV radiation, the essential plasticizers within the single-ply membrane had completely degraded. This chemical breakdown left the sheet paper-thin, split, and completely see-through down the main ridge peak.
Because Erez membranes are long discontinued, they are completely incompatible with modern repair materials, and new TPO cannot be reliably heat-welded to the weathered, chalky surface.
In this case, the compromised peak allowed massive amounts of heavy rainwater to migrate directly beneath the single-ply sheets. Over months of undetected leaks, the water pooled inside the membrane laps, creating heavy, sagging pockets. The weight of this trapped water completely collapsed the underlying insulation boards, turning the sub-roof cavity into a dark, stagnant breeding ground for thick green algae slime.
Draining the Laps & Executing Emergency Tarping Mitigation
Before any permanent replacement work could begin, our primary goal was protecting the homeowner's interior ceilings from immediate storm water intrusion. We systematically cut and drained the heavy, water-logged membrane laps, releasing gallons of stagnant, trapped water to alleviate the dead-load stress on the structural roof deck.
Once the pooling water was fully drained, our crew secured the entire flat roof system under an emergency, heavy-duty protective tarp. This temporary mitigation sealed the open ridge peak and torn seams, giving the homeowner complete peace of mind while we worked out a long-term structural solution.
A Dunedin Community Pulls Together for a Neighbor in Need
Because the homeowner was facing severe financial difficulties and the emotional weight of losing his wife, the cost of a full flat roof replacement seemed completely out of reach. That is when the Dunedin community showed its true strength.
As soon as we finished the emergency tarping, a compassionate neighbor stepped forward and paid for the inspection and tarping bill on the spot. To support their incredible gesture, Clean 2 Preserve heavily discounted our standard mitigation rates.
But the community spirit did not stop there. When it came time to execute the permanent roof-over, the entire neighborhood and park community pulled together, managing to donate and raise 65 percent of the total roof replacement cost. Clean 2 Preserve matched their incredible generosity by donating our remaining labor and material margins, significantly dropping the final rate to ensure this deserving gentleman received a brand-new, lifetime watertight roof.
Installing a Brand-New, Heavy-Duty Mule-Hide TPO System
Once the funding was secured, our certified crew executed a clean, structural tear-off of the rotted Erez membrane and saturated insulation. We installed a brand-new, high-density polystyrene insulation board foundation to restore a completely flat, structurally sound substrate.
On top of the new insulation base, we rolled out and mechanically fastened a premium, commercial-grade Mule-Hide white TPO single-ply membrane. We heat-fused all lap seams at a molecular level using professional Leister hot-air guns, fully flashed the vertical wall transitions, and sealed the perimeter with heavy-duty metal termination bars.
